JAMES W. RILEY, Defendant Below, Appellant, v. STATE OF DELAWARE, Plaintiff Below, Appellee.


Court Below—Superior Court of the State of Delaware, in and for Kent County Cr. ID 0004014504

Before BERGER, JACOBS, and RIDGELY, Justices.

ORDER

This 26th day of January 2012, after careful consideration of the parties' briefs and the record on appeal, we find it manifest that the judgment below should be affirmed on the basis of the Superior Court's order adopting the Commissioner's well-reasoned recommendation dated November 23, 2010. The Superior Court did not err in concluding that appellant's motion for postconviction relief was both untimely and procedurally barred under Superior Court Criminal Rule 61 (i) (3) and that appellant had failed to establish a colorable claim of a miscarriage of justice sufficient to overcome the procedural hurdles.

NOW, THEREFORE, IT IS ORDERED that the judgment of the Superior Court is AFFIRMED.
